Ben Kingsley visits Taj Mahal

Oscar winning actor Ben Kingsley, who plans to make a film on Taj Mahal, Wednesday visited the monument along with his wife Daniela Lavender.

He spent more than two hours at the Taj and mingled with visitors, many of whom took pictures with the 67-year-old.

Sir Ben plans to play Mughal emperor Shah Jahan in his dream project called "Taj", Daniela will act as Kandhari Begum, Shah Jahan's first wife of Persian origin, While Bollywood actress Aishwarya Rai may feature as Mumtaz Mahal.

Sources said the film would bring out the loneliness of Shah Jahan and the intense love he had for his wife Mumtaz Mahal, who died delivering their 14th child.

The final copy of the script is ready and Kingsley will be now scouting for funds for his $25-27 million project, which is likely to go on floors next year.
